  • Abstract
    The values of the information categories “density”, “texture” and “contour” correlates with the information loss caused by the reduction of the image scale. For large scales the information loss of the category “density” is greater than the information loss of the categories “texture” and “contour”. This is reverse for small scales. For different amounts of density ranges an estimation of scale numbers is done for which this reverse case is valid
